We also visited the farm of Wan van Overveld in Son. That farm is situated on the drop zones where September 17, 1944, between 13:00 en 13:30 hrs. 6669 Para's jumped at the start of Operation Market Garden Still, every year, a lot of veterans visit the the van Overveld family, most of the time during September. Every visitor receives a warm welcome. To show them their gratitude, Easy Company gave them a commemoration plaque which reminds of that memorable day in September 1944. |

For years Mr.van Overveld worked on his farm and found, years after the war, a parachute that still was in good shape though it was buried for years. He kept it careful in his house and made a tradition out of it to unfold it every time veterans come and visit his farm on the drop zones. In short : People who still wish the veterans well.! |
